新聞中心
Redis管道:更快的性能優(yōu)勢(shì)

創(chuàng)新互聯(lián)專業(yè)為企業(yè)提供廣安網(wǎng)站建設(shè)、廣安做網(wǎng)站、廣安網(wǎng)站設(shè)計(jì)、廣安網(wǎng)站制作等企業(yè)網(wǎng)站建設(shè)、網(wǎng)頁(yè)設(shè)計(jì)與制作、廣安企業(yè)網(wǎng)站模板建站服務(wù),10多年廣安做網(wǎng)站經(jīng)驗(yàn),不只是建網(wǎng)站,更提供有價(jià)值的思路和整體網(wǎng)絡(luò)服務(wù)。
Redis是一個(gè)高性能的內(nèi)存數(shù)據(jù)存儲(chǔ)系統(tǒng)。在處理大量數(shù)據(jù)時(shí),性能成為了至關(guān)重要的因素。為了提高Redis的性能,Redis管道應(yīng)運(yùn)而生。
Redis管道是一種能夠?qū)⒍鄠€(gè)Redis操作一次性提交到服務(wù)器上執(zhí)行的技術(shù)。在實(shí)際應(yīng)用中,Redis管道可以將多個(gè)命令集成成一個(gè)批處理,通過(guò)一次網(wǎng)絡(luò)請(qǐng)求來(lái)執(zhí)行多個(gè)Redis命令。這樣可以大大減少網(wǎng)絡(luò)損耗、網(wǎng)絡(luò)延遲和IO操作,從而提高Redis的性能。
Redis管道的使用方法非常簡(jiǎn)單,只需要使用Redis客戶端提供的Pipeline類創(chuàng)建一個(gè)管道對(duì)象,然后將需要執(zhí)行的Redis命令放入管道中即可。下面是一個(gè)簡(jiǎn)單的Python代碼示例:
import redis
r = redis.StrictRedis(host='localhost', port=6379, db=0)
pipe = r.pipeline()
pipe.set('key1', 'value1')
pipe.set('key2', 'value2')
pipe.set('key3', 'value3')
pipe.execute()
這個(gè)示例代碼創(chuàng)建了一個(gè)Redis客戶端對(duì)象,然后使用Pipeline對(duì)象將三個(gè)Redis命令放入管道中,最后使用execute()方法執(zhí)行所有Redis命令。
通過(guò)管道技術(shù),Redis可以批量執(zhí)行一組操作,從而減少網(wǎng)絡(luò)開(kāi)銷,提高系統(tǒng)性能。在實(shí)際應(yīng)用中,管道技術(shù)可以用于批量處理、大規(guī)模數(shù)據(jù)導(dǎo)入、數(shù)據(jù)同步等場(chǎng)景下,優(yōu)化Redis的性能表現(xiàn)。
當(dāng)然,Redis管道也存在一些限制和注意事項(xiàng),需要在使用時(shí)予以考慮。例如,管道在執(zhí)行過(guò)程中,所有Redis命令都不會(huì)立即得到執(zhí)行和響應(yīng),需要等待所有命令執(zhí)行完畢后才會(huì)返回結(jié)果。因此,在進(jìn)行數(shù)據(jù)操作時(shí),需要考慮數(shù)據(jù)的一致性和處理順序的要求。
Redis管道是一種高性能的Redis數(shù)據(jù)操作技術(shù),它可以通過(guò)批量執(zhí)行Redis命令來(lái)優(yōu)化系統(tǒng)性能,同時(shí)需要注意其在一致性和處理順序方面的限制。在實(shí)際應(yīng)用中,我們可以結(jié)合實(shí)際業(yè)務(wù)場(chǎng)景,靈活使用Redis管道技術(shù),以提高系統(tǒng)性能和響應(yīng)速度。
香港服務(wù)器選創(chuàng)新互聯(lián),2H2G首月10元開(kāi)通。
創(chuàng)新互聯(lián)(www.cdcxhl.com)互聯(lián)網(wǎng)服務(wù)提供商,擁有超過(guò)10年的服務(wù)器租用、服務(wù)器托管、云服務(wù)器、虛擬主機(jī)、網(wǎng)站系統(tǒng)開(kāi)發(fā)經(jīng)驗(yàn)。專業(yè)提供云主機(jī)、虛擬主機(jī)、域名注冊(cè)、VPS主機(jī)、云服務(wù)器、香港云服務(wù)器、免備案服務(wù)器等。
網(wǎng)頁(yè)標(biāo)題:Redis管道更快的性能優(yōu)勢(shì)(redis管道實(shí)現(xiàn))
當(dāng)前URL:http://fisionsoft.com.cn/article/dhcjjdp.html


咨詢
建站咨詢
